Local rally and candlelight vigil calls for an end to violence against the Asian-American and Pacific Islander community People gathered Saturday in Lancaster, calling for change and hoping to spark a discussion about inclusion and diversity. Author: FOX43 Newsroom Updated: 12:14 AM EDT May 16, 2021 LANCASTER, Pa. A rally and candlelight vigil took place in Lancaster Saturday evening, calling for an end to violence and discrimination against the Asian-American and Pacific Islander community. It comes following an uptick in reported hate crimes nationwide, targeting Asian-Americans and Pacific Islanders. The event was organized by 23-year-old Julia Cao, and featured speakers from several different organizations including Church World Service, the Lancaster Interfaith Coalition, and YWCA Lancaster.
